BILLING CODE 4510-30-P DEPARTMENT OF LABOR Employment and Training Administration [TA-W-39,471] Besser Co., Alpena Michigan; Notice of Affirmative Determination Regarding Application for Reconsideration By letter of January 4, 2002, the International Brotherhood of Boilermakers, Local Lodge D-472 requested administrative reconsideration of the Department of Labor's Notice of Negative Determination Regarding Eligibility to Apply for Worker Adjustment Assistance, applicable to workers of the subject firm.
The denial notice was signed on November 27, 2001, and published in the **Federal Register** on December 18, 2001 (66 FR 65220). The Department reviewed the request for reconsideration and has determined that the Department will examine the petitioner's allegation claiming that the Department did not survey a representative sample of the subject firm's customer base. Conclusion After careful review of the application, I conclude that the claim is of sufficient weight to justify reconsideration of the Department of Labor's prior decision.
The application is, therefore, granted. Signed at Washington, DC, this 26th day of April, 2002. Edward A. Tomchick, Director, Division of Trade Adjustment Assistance. [FR Doc. 02-13940 Filed 6-3-02; 8:45 am]
